Understanding Your Rights and Responsibilities

Before you even start writing, it’s crucial to understand your rights as a player and the casino’s responsibilities. Most reputable online casinos in Hungary are licensed and regulated, meaning they have to adhere to certain standards. This includes things like fair play, secure transactions, and responsive customer service. Familiarize yourself with the terms and conditions of the specific casino you’re playing at. These documents often outline the complaint process, including how to submit a complaint and the expected timeframe for a response. Keep copies of all your communications, including emails, chat logs, and any screenshots that support your claim. This documentation is your evidence.

Crafting Your Complaint: A Step-by-Step Guide

Now, let’s get down to the nitty-gritty of writing a complaint that gets results.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

1. Be Clear and Concise

Get straight to the point. State the issue clearly and avoid unnecessary fluff. What exactly happened? When did it happen? Where did it happen (e.g., specific game, specific bonus)? The more specific you are, the easier it is for the casino to understand the problem and find a solution.

2. Provide Detailed Information

Include all relevant details. This might include:

  • Your username and account details.
  • The date and time of the incident.
  • The name of the game or bonus involved.
  • The amount of money involved.
  • Any error messages you received.
  • Screenshots or other supporting evidence.

The more information you provide, the better. It helps the casino investigate the issue thoroughly.

3. Explain the Problem Clearly

Describe the problem in a logical and easy-to-understand manner. Explain what you believe went wrong and why you are dissatisfied. Be factual and avoid emotional language. Stick to the facts and let the evidence speak for itself.

4. State Your Desired Outcome

What do you want the casino to do to resolve the issue? Do you want a refund? Do you want the bonus credited? Do you want the winnings paid out? Be specific about your desired outcome. This helps the casino understand your expectations and work towards a resolution.

5. Be Polite but Firm

Even though you’re frustrated, it’s important to remain polite and professional in your communication. Using respectful language increases the likelihood of a positive response. However, don’t be afraid to be firm. Clearly state your expectations and reiterate the facts of the situation.

6. Proofread Carefully

Before you send your complaint, take a moment to proofread it. Check for any grammatical errors or typos. A well-written complaint demonstrates that you are serious about the issue and increases the chances of it being taken seriously by the casino.

Where to Submit Your Complaint

Most online casinos have a dedicated customer support section. This is usually the first place to start. Look for options like:

  • Live Chat: This is often the quickest way to get a response.
  • Email: Most casinos have a specific email address for complaints.
  • Online Form: Many casinos have a contact form on their website.
  • Phone: Some casinos offer phone support, but this is less common.

Always keep a record of your communication. Save copies of your emails and chat logs. This documentation will be crucial if you need to escalate the complaint further.

What to Do If You’re Not Satisfied

Sometimes, the casino’s initial response isn’t satisfactory. Here’s what you can do:

  • Escalate the Complaint: Ask to speak to a supervisor or manager. Often, a higher-level employee has more authority to resolve the issue.
  • Contact the Licensing Authority: If the casino is licensed, you can contact the regulatory body that issued the license. They can investigate the complaint and ensure the casino is following the rules.
  • Seek Independent Mediation: Some organizations offer independent mediation services to help resolve disputes between players and casinos.
